​𝐒𝐄𝐍𝐀𝐓𝐄 𝐂𝐎𝐌𝐌𝐈𝐓𝐓𝐄𝐄 𝐅𝐋𝐀𝐆𝐒 𝐎𝐏𝐄𝐑𝐀𝐓𝐈𝐎𝐍𝐀𝐋 𝐀𝐍𝐃 𝐅𝐈𝐍𝐀𝐍𝐂𝐈𝐀𝐋 𝐆𝐀𝐏𝐒 𝐈𝐍 𝐕𝐈𝐇𝐈𝐆𝐀 𝐌𝐔𝐍𝐈𝐂𝐈𝐏𝐀𝐋𝐈𝐓Y ​

​The Senate Standing Committee on Devolution and Intergovernmental Relations today held a meeting with Vihiga County Governor Wilberforce Otichillo to scrutinize the governance, operations, and financial autonomy of the county’s municipalities.

 

This follows recent findings by the Senate County Public Investments and Special Funds Committee, which revealed that multiple municipalities across the country have been granted charters but remain un-operationalized due to a lack of autonomy from county executives.

𝐇𝐈𝐆𝐇 𝐂𝐎𝐔𝐑𝐓 𝐕𝐀𝐋𝐈𝐃𝐀𝐓𝐄𝐒 𝐓𝐇𝐄 𝐕𝐄𝐓𝐓𝐈𝐍𝐆 𝐀𝐍𝐃 𝐀𝐏𝐏𝐑𝐎𝐕𝐀𝐋 𝐎𝐅 𝐂𝐒𝐬 𝐀𝐅𝐓𝐄𝐑 𝟐𝟎𝟐𝟒 𝐂𝐀𝐁𝐈𝐍𝐄𝐓 𝐃𝐈𝐒𝐒𝐎𝐋𝐔𝐓𝐈𝐎𝐍

 

The High Court recently dismissed a Petition that had sought to annul the current Cabinet, over queries raised on the nomination, vetting, approval and appointment process of the Cabinet Secretaries (CSs) following the President’s dissolution of Cabinet in 2024.

The Petitioners had sued the President, members of his Cabinet, The Speaker of the National Assembly and the Office of the Attorney General, among others.
